ERA Syllabus

Classroom Session

Riding a motorcycle is a complex journey. Learn simple techniques to make your rides more enjoyable. A short classroom session will prepare you for the day’s events and help you become a better rider.

Slow & Medium Speed Drills (Skid Pad)

After the classroom session, we will use the controlled environment of a skid pad to refine your slow- and medium-speed bike handling skills. These drills serve as the foundation for your real-world two-wheeled journeys.

Higher Speed Training (Nelson Circuit)

Now that we have built your foundation on the skid pad, we will move to the road circuit. We intentionally avoid calling it a “race track” because this is not a track day. Our goal is to make you a skilled rider, not a fast one. The road circuit provides an opportunity to practice drills at highway speeds, helping you improve at the speeds you typically ride.
